Abstract

The invention discloses a mobile terminal processing method and a mobile terminal. The method comprises the following steps that: an AOME in the mobile terminal receives a script used for realizing a user automatic operation function and configures the script to the AOME, wherein the script comprises indication information and control logic, the indication information is used for indicating to call application and/or overall equipment on the mobile terminal, and the control logic is used for indicating to call the logic sequence of the application and/or overall equipment; and the AOME analyzes the script and calls the application and/or overall equipment according to the indication information and the control logic to realize the user automatic operation function. By the method and through the mobile terminal, a user can realize self-defined automatic operation, so that higher freedom degree is undoubtedly provided for the user to use the mobile terminal.

Background technology
Along with the development of mobile communication technology and microelectric technique, mobile communication terminal (being designated hereinafter simply as mobile terminal) is different obviously with the trend day that palmtop PC merges.The user wishes that not only mobile terminal can realize intrinsic communication function (for example, making a phone call, send short messages etc.), wishes that also mobile phone can provide the functions such as document process, online, game, multimedia.
In recent years, also become one of direction of user's request by the automatic processing transactions of mobile terminal.For example, some business users wishes that mobile terminal can regularly receive mail from network, uploads the download document; Younger user may wish to pay close attention in real time Power Flow Information etc.
At present, the user only can use and (for example be configured in application that the manufacturer terminal on mobile terminal provides, alarm clock, commemoration day are reminded etc.) realize the automatic operation function that some are fairly simple, the automatic operation kind that manufacturer terminal provides is less, and flexibility is low, can not arbitrarily carry out automatic operation according to user's wish.

Embodiment 1
Fig. 6 is the configuration diagram according to the automatic operation model (Automatic Operating Module) that is used for realizing user's automatic operation in the mobile terminal of embodiment 1, as shown in Figure 6, one of running background is used the basic function of being responsible for AOM when system starts, and the foreground provides a foreground application to be used for carrying out alternately with the user simultaneously.Intermediate layer TNM provides the communication mechanism of AOM and other application.The below is elaborated respectively with regard to each functional module.This embodiment realizes on binary runtime environment for wireless, and the realization on other platform can with reference to binary runtime environment for wireless, will repeat no more.
(1) AOME, this module is that the privilege that runs on the backstage is used, and is responsible for user-defined instruction is made an explanation and carries out, and controls the enforcement of logic.AOME receives the synchronous event that TNM transmits, and corresponding operational order is issued the application (or overall equipment) of user's appointment.This module comprises following sub-function module: the explanation of user's script carries out, grandly record, the administering and maintaining of Notification, operational effect monitoring (comprising log recording, miscue etc.).
(2) CPM, it is the application program of an independent operating, serves as the general name of functional entity that is used for realizing the automatic operation function that AOM(comprises the modules such as AOME, TNM) and the user between interface.The user can assign the instruction that starts or stops, import script etc. to AOM by CPM.Its concrete subfunction is as follows: On/Off AOM function, start/stop specify script or grand, import script or macro document, beginning/stopping recording, user by this CPM definition or registration or nullify Trigger and Notification, simple script editor.
(3) TNM-L, TNM-L exists as the part of application program, is not independently to use.It is responsible for collecting by AOM predefine, the inner a series of Trigger that occur of application program, and the Notification that it is corresponding sends to AOME in real time.The definition of predefine Notification is left in the configuration file of AOM with the form of code, and defining which notice by producer should be monitored by AOM.The locomotive function modules such as general clock, note, incoming call can define built-in Triggers separately, specifically need which state of monitoring to be determined according to actual conditions and user's request by development company fully, and can carry out cutting or expansion to these predefined Trigger by edition upgrading.
(4) TNM-G is different from TNM-L, and the global monitoring module is also an independently application program; But, because TNM-G also should at running background, therefore also can with the part of TNM-G as the AOME function, be put in AOME as a submodule existence.TNM-G mainly is responsible for global resource is monitored, can be as the monitored object of TNM-G as LED, file system, the network equipment etc.Development company can open the monitoring function of particular device selectively to the user, and the Trigger of correspondence defined by the user is synchronizeed with AOME.
TNM-L and TNM-G safeguard a timer that is under the jurisdiction of self separately, and the call back function of this timer will be used the Trigger list of registering under traveling through self, if the Trigger in list is triggered, send corresponding Notification to AOME.
(5) script, script can be with grand mode direct recording to AOME, also can write in advance to be dumped on mobile device from PC equipment again.The instruction set that script need to provide generally comprises following several respects:
The registration and unregistration of A.Trigger and Notification: the user need to indicate to AOM the occurrence condition (being equivalent to the trigger conditions in control logic) of (specifically indicating to AOME) this event.Such as LED equipment, when the user may certain several pixel be specific RGB color on screen, send a Notification to AOME.
B. the logical order that calling application and/or overall equipment in control logic, generally realize by general mathematical and logical order.
C. be used to indicate the indication information that calls application and/or overall equipment, can comprise: the built-in function of specific function, the instruction of assigned operation (such as button, touch-screen slip etc.), user IO instruction (as user log output, screen prompt information etc.) etc.
Embodiment 2
This embodiment has described the process that above AOM carries out user-defined automatic operation of using by way of example, this embodiment is based on following scene: the user automatically replies with convention after wishing to receive the note that the mobile phone of assigned number sends, and the user can do following setting so:
Step 1, compile script, the mobile phone that appointment need to automatically reply and the content of reply;
Step 2 specifies AOM to move this script by CPM;
Step 3, script begin to monitor the SMS notification (supposing that OEM defines this notice and is AOM_SM_INCOMING) that sends from the TNM-L layer of SMS module;
Step 4, after new message was received, the AOM_SM_INCOMING notice was dealt into AOM, and script parses the other side sender; If sender coupling starts the create message interface by the mode that sends Keyboard Message, predetermined content is write note and sends back to the other side.
Embodiment 3
Fig. 7 uses mobile phone browser repeatedly to download the flow chart of a file chaining according to the test of embodiment 3, Trigger1 and Trigger2 are the triggers of two registrations, if be predefined, these two triggers will send Notification to AOME automatically by browser; If there is no predefine, the user just needs oneself to register them and sends corresponding Notification: definition of T rigger1 and be displayed on LED as the sectional drawing at browser master interface, and definition of T rigger2 is that the characteristic point pixel of the character string of designated links is shown.Process 4 is subprocess that comprise several steps, wherein needs equally several triggers of definition and notice, repeats no more here.As shown in Figure 7, this automatic operation process comprises the following steps:
Step 1, script brings into operation;
Step 2 starts browser;
Step 3, whether Trigger1 detects browser and starts, if change step 4 over to, if overtime startup changes step 10 over to;
Step 4 forwards designated links to;
Step 5, whether Trigger2 detects designated links and is opened, if, enter step 6, if overtime not opening returned to step 4 and continued to process, until expired times have surpassed Retry time default number, change step 10 over to;
Step 6 is downloaded this link;
Step 7 is included into statistics with the result of this download, comprises speed of download, the frequency of failure, response speed etc.;
Step 8 judges whether the testing time that reaches default, if, enter step 9, otherwise, return to step 6 and continue to process;
Step 9 outputs test result;
Step 10 enters wrong handling process, for example, error message is shown to user, misregistration daily record etc.
